Our Love Forever Sweet
The bitter icicle wind pierces the words "I love you"
Before they reach your opal ears
In a dream we laugh! and tumble in long grasses;
Your hair, brushing my face, your scent
Flushing my heart
Pausing, we each gather honeysuckle blossoms
Playfully guiding the stems to each other's lips
Nibbling sweet nectar as our lips melt together
Gently
We awake entwined in each other's arms
Our Love
Forever Sweet
